Full description

The aim of this trial is to verify that neurostimulated parkinsonian patients gain weight and to study its link with an energetic balance change.

Twenty parkinsonian patients will be randomised : the delay between inclusion and neurostimulation wil be lengthened 3 months for one group, compared to the second one. The energy expenditure, at rest and after ingestion of a test meal, will be compared between the group of patients that had been neurostimulated and the group whose intervention has been postponed. Weight changes, energy intake, leptin level, neurophysiological parameters will be compared between both groups, and the nature and repartition of the weight gain will be assessed in the neurostimulated group. An eventual link between motor factors, pharmacological factors, and gain weight will be studied.

Inclusion criteria

  • Age between 35 and 70; male or female; parkinson disease, with levo dopa response (at least 30%); severe but stable incapacity; no dementia, no psychosis, no depression; normal brain scanner done during the last 2 years.

Exclusion criteria

  • diabetes thyroid disease pacemaker coagulation troubles previous drug abuse
